Incorrect Florida Communication Services Tax being charged
While I don't believe there is a criminal intent to defraud Florida citizens, I would like to bring to your attention that ATT U-verse has been charging me a Communication Service Tax at an incorrect rate.
I have made efforts to make ATT U-verse aware of the problem.
My address, one of hundreds of addresses that had changed due to St Lucie / Martin county, change of boundary SB800 legislation July 1, 2013, and is most likely a problem for ATT U-Verse.
Communication Service Tax rates are determined by address jurisdiction information provided by the State of Florida. This information is correct. My tax rate is 1.84%, Unincorporated Martin County. It seems that ATT is charging me the City of Stuart tax rate of 5.22%.
The State of Florida gives ATT U-verse an allowance of .75% to collect these taxes without error. From my point of view, there are errors and no way to make ATT U-verse aware of these errors.
I challenge everyone to call their TV or Phone provider and ask the tax rate and how Communication Service Taxes are calculated on their bill. The most likely answer you will get is the state tells us how much to charge and therefore your bill is correct.

This is follow up to let everyone know ATT UVerse billing of Communication Service Tax has been corrected on my bill. Once I found the corporate office phone number, called, explained the problem. They were quick to follow up and correct the problem.

Well, it's been a little over a year.
The wife got a new phone and I got my first bill with this phone from AT&T, guess what?
The new phone now has a line item of "11. County Surtax" which looks to be about .30% the rate of St. Lucie County.
My phone does not have this line item, same account. Which I have been assuming because Martin County does not have Surtax.
Both counties have the same rate of 1.840 % for Communication Service tax.
I will contact AT&T and make the effort to have this corrected and keep you informed.
Again, this is minor amount of money not worth the effort of complaining but, I wonder how many consumers are being ripped-off while AT&T is being rewarded to collect these taxes.
